Color Psychology and Elemental Balance

The elementsβwood, fire, earth, metal, and waterβplay a significant role in balancing a space. Depending on the orientation of your home or school, you might need to introduce elements that are missing. For instance, the color blue (water element) can calm an overstimulated mind, while green (wood element) fosters growth.
